Federal judge orders Trump to rehire agency workers laid off in mass firings
In a show of resistance to US President Donald Trump's drastic efforts to reduce the federal workforce, a District Judge on Thursday ordered the Trump administration to rehire probationary workers it had laid off since coming into power. The White House swiftly appealed the ruling – a lawsuit jointly filed by numerous labor unions – labeling it an encroachment on executive powers.
